Feature overview
Reflection probe designed to be used with a single excitation 638 nm wavelength (up to 300 mW). Suitable to work with DropSens Raman cell for screen-printed electrodes (ref. RAMANCELL), Raman cell for conventional electrodes (ref. RAMANCELL-C) or with any conventional Raman set-up.

- Spectroelectrochemical Raman instrument (638 nm laser)
- DRP-SPELECRAMAN638
- SPELECRAMAN638 is an instrument for performing spectroelectrochemical Raman measurements. It combines in only one box a laser class 3B (638 nm ± 0.5), a bipotentiostat/galvanostat and a spectrometer (wavelength range 640 – 885 nm and Raman shift 50 – 4370 cm-1) and includes a dedicated spectroelectrochemical software that allows optical and electrochemical experiments synchronization.
